F&W ECOL/SURG SCI 548 — DISEASES OF WILDLIFE
3 credits.
Provides an overview of the issues involved across a wide range of wildlife diseases, presented within the context of ecosystem health or "one health". Content will be on the biological, epidemiological, clinical, public health and, in some cases, sociopolitical ramifications of wildlife diseases. Covers a wide variety of wildlife diseases caused by bacteria, viruses, parasites, prions, and environmental contaminants. Consequences associated with environmental changes on the manifestation of wildlife diseases will also be discussed. This range of diseases will be presented in order to familiarize the many facets involved in disease management, from animal and human health issues, to ecological and environmental considerations, to the role of society in contributing to, and managing, these diseases.

F&W ECOL/ENTOM 711 — MULTIVARIATE ANALYSIS OF ECOLOGICAL AND COMMUNITY DATA
2 credits.
Examines common methods of multivariate data analysis in ecology and environmental science. Covers methods for the analysis of complex, multidimensional datasets that are collected in the study of plant, invertebrate, fish, and bird communities. Addresses the concurrent analysis of the environmental factors that may drive community distributions. Provides the basis for predictive modeling of distributions across landscapes. General methods covered include ordination (PCA, DCA, NMDS, CCA), clustering (or classification), and other comparative analyses of data matrices (ANOSIM, Mantel tests). Includes an applied, "hands-on" approach on how to use these tools, and the circumstances under which their uses are either appropriate or inappropriate.
